Eberspacher Hydronic FAQ


How do I know if I need a D4, D5 or D10?

The big thing to remember when specifying a heater is that it will want to cycle right through its power output (from low to high and vice-versa) rather than be running flat out or on tick over all the time. The key to achieving that aim is:

a)      Specify approximately the right size heater for your application (please call us to ask)

b)      Connect the Eberspacher Hydronic up to the correct capacity of radiators to allow it to function as the manufacturer intended. A good guide is that a 5kw heater will want atleast 5kw of radiators through which to lose heat.

Specifying the correct heater for the job is not as complex as it sounds, drop us an email or give us a call and we will happily talk you through it.

Will it need servicing?

Yes, any complex diesel heating product needs servicing in order to clean out the build up of soot and carbon, and to replace all relevant filters and consumables. You should allow for your heater to be serviced annually or at-least bi-annually.
